GRIEF SHARE A GRIEF RECOVERY SUPPORT GROUP
BEGINS WEDNESDAY, SEPTEMBER 8 at 6:30 PM
If you, or someone you know, has lost a spouse, child, family member or friend, you’ve probably found that there are not many people who understand the deep hurt you feel. That is the reason for this special seminar and support group for people grieving the loss of someone close. Each session includes a video seminar featuring top experts on grief and recovery subjects followed by small group discussion. DO YOU NEED A FRIEND?
Are there ever times you feel alone? Would you like someone to pray with you... to listen to you... to just sit with you? Have you ever felt that, with just a little encouragement, you could carry on? God has gifted certain unique persons in our congregation to be such a friend. Responding to the Holy Spirit’s call, these individuals have gone through over 50 hours of training. They have studied, discussed and prepared themselves to be Stephen Ministers. The ministry provides confidential guidance and a person who will pray for you and with you. Both men and women have made themselves available and have prepared for this ministry.
